For many years, the direct use of geothermal resources in Mexico has been underestimated; although there are few places exploiting it, it is only used for recreational purposes such as baths or spas. Over the past 30 years, the electricity supplier in Mexico (Comisión Federal de Electricidad, CFE) has explored, drilled and developed geothermal projects all over the country, having only the aim of large scale electricity generation. Sometimes, wells in zones with appropriate conditions for a direct use benefit, are abandoned. Most of these wells and studies are located in areas where the economic development is poor and the implementation of direct use geothermal projects such as greenhouses, fish farms, drying processes, heating processes, evaporation and distillation processes, washing, desalination and chemical extraction, may improve this situation with the increase of jobs and opportunities to these communities. The objective of this study is to make an overview of the potential zones in Mexico suitable for the development of geothermal direct uses, and to choose a specific location to apply it
